WebFeb 25, 2024 · The key to preventing bleed through is using a quality stain-blocking primer. That’s it! The best stain-blocking primers are shellac-based primers, like Zinsser B-I-N primer. Shellac primers will completely prevent stains or tannins from seeping through to the painted surface. The problem with shellac-based primers is that they STINK!
